Fiber optic cables transmit data using light rather than electricity, making them inherently immune to electromagnetic interference (EMI) from nearby power lines, including 380V systems . This allows fiber optics to be installed close to electrical circuits without risk of signal degradation or short circuits. For aerial or high-voltage environments, All-Dielectric Self-Supporting (ADSS) fiber optic cables are commonly used. These cables have no metallic components, eliminating the risk of arcing and ensuring safe operation near energized conductors .
